Poverty Rate in Tulsa County, Oklahoma
Tulsa County, Oklahoma has a poverty rate of 14.7%, which ranks #1,897 of 3,222 out of 3,222 counties nationwide. This is 16.8% above the national value of 12.6%.
Within Oklahoma, Tulsa County ranks #24 of 77 out of 77 counties. This places it in the 41th percentile nationally.
Percentage of the population living below the federal poverty line. All data comes from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ates for 2024.
